Mennonite Weekly Review obituary: 1949 Jan 13 p. 4
Birth date: 1909
text of obituary:
MEETS INSTANT DEATH IN CROSSING TRAGEDY
Hillsboro, Kansas. — Jacob Peters, 40, of Delavan, Wisc., was instantly killed near there on Christmas day when his milk truck was struck by a train, according to word received by relatives here. Funeral services there on Dec. 28 were attended by his father, H. D. Peters, of Shafter, Calif., and a brother, Henry, of Delft, Minn.
Also surviving are five children. Mrs. Peters died several years ago.
